Prince Ouran

In Bordeaux in 1862, a suffering spirit announced himself spontaneously as Ouran, formerly a Russian prince. He had rank, wealth, and power, but pride and cruelty ruined him.

The medium’s hand begins writing...

MediumWill you give us some details about your condition?

Prince OuranBlessed are the poor in spirit, for theirs is the kingdom of Heaven.

Prince OuranPray for me.

Prince OuranHappy are those who, in humility of heart, choose a modest place for their trials.

Prince OuranYou who are consumed by envy don't know what those you call the favorites of fortune are reduced to.

Prince OuranYou don't see the burning coals they heap on their own heads.

Prince OuranYou don't know what sacrifices riches demand from those who would use them for their progress in the spirit world.

Prince OuranMay the Lord allow me, the proud despot, to return and atone among those I crushed by my tyranny for the crimes pride made me commit.

Prince OuranPride. Repeat that word again and again, and never forget that pride is the source of all our sufferings.

Prince OuranYes, I abused the power and favor I enjoyed.

Prince OuranI was harsh and cruel to those below me.

Prince OuranI forced them to submit to all my whims and all my corrupt desires.

Prince OuranI had chosen rank, honors, and fortune, and I fell under the weight of a trial beyond my strength.

Kardec briefly notes that suffering spirits often say a trial was beyond their strength because pride still wants to excuse failure.

MediumYou are aware of your faults. That is the first step toward improvement.

Prince OuranThat awareness is another suffering for me.

Prince OuranFor many spirits, suffering is almost physical, because they're still under the influence of the material side of their last life and can't yet feel moral suffering clearly.

Prince OuranMy spirit is now free enough from matter, but my moral feeling has gained all the force people imagine physical pain to have.

MediumDo you see the end of your suffering?

Prince OuranI know it won't be eternal, but I don't yet see its end.

Prince OuranFor that, I have to go through another trial.

MediumDo you expect to begin again soon?

Prince OuranI still don't know.

MediumDo you remember anything of your earlier lives? I ask for the sake of instruction.

Prince OuranYes.

Prince OuranYour guides are here, and they know what's best for you.

Prince OuranI lived in the time of Marcus Aurelius. In that life too, I had power, and again I fell through pride, the cause of all our failures.

Prince OuranAfter wandering for many centuries, I decided to try a life of obscurity.

Prince OuranAs a poor student, I begged for my bread, but my natural pride was still with me.

Prince OuranMy spirit gained knowledge, but not virtue.

Prince OuranLearned and ambitious, I sold myself to whoever paid most for my services, serving every hatred and every revenge.

Prince OuranI felt my wickedness, but my thirst for honors and riches made me deaf to the voice of my conscience.

Prince OuranThe atonement for that life was long and terrible.

Prince OuranAt last I decided, in my last life, to face again the temptations of luxury and power.

Prince OuranThinking I was strong enough, I refused to listen to those who tried to warn me away from that attempt.

Prince OuranPride once again made me trust my own judgment instead of the advice of the protecting friends who never stop watching over us.

Prince OuranYou know the result of that last attempt.

Prince OuranAt last I understand my weakness and my foolishness, and I place my hope in the help of God.

Prince OuranI have laid my miserable pride at His feet, and I've begged Him to place on my shoulders the heaviest burden of humility. With His help, that burden will seem light.

Prince OuranPray with me and for me.

Prince OuranPray also for yourselves, that the demon of pride may never gain power over your minds.

Prince OuranBrothers in suffering, let my example enlighten you.

Prince OuranNever forget that pride is the enemy of happiness.

Prince OuranPride causes all the evils that strike the human race and follow it even into the spirit world.

The guide then explained that, even in suffering, this spirit's humility was sincere.

Mediums’ GuideYou felt some doubt about this spirit's sincerity because his words didn't seem to fit the backward state suggested by his suffering.

Mediums’ GuideBe at peace on that point. What he said is true.

Mediums’ GuideHowever great his suffering, he is advanced enough in intelligence to speak this way.

Mediums’ GuideWhat he lacked was humility, and without humility no spirit can rise toward God.

Mediums’ GuideHe has now gained that humility, and we hope that, if he remains faithful to his new resolutions, he will come out victorious from his next trial.

Mediums’ GuideOur heavenly Father is all justice and wisdom.

Mediums’ GuideHe takes into account every effort a person makes to overcome evil instincts.

Mediums’ GuideEvery victory over ourselves lifts us one more step on the ladder whose lower end is on Earth and whose upper end stands before God.

Mediums’ GuideClimb that ladder bravely.

Mediums’ GuideIts steps are easy to reach for the one whose will is truly engaged in the work.

Mediums’ GuideAlways look upward for courage, because unfortunate is the one who stops and turns his head.

Mediums’ GuideThe emptiness around him will confuse him, and he'll say, what is the use of going on? I've gained so little.

Mediums’ GuideNo, my dear friends, do not look away.

Mediums’ GuidePride is deep in the human heart, but make that very feeling serve to give you strength and courage for your ascent.

Mediums’ GuideUse your time to overcome your weaknesses, and keep climbing toward the summit of the eternal mountain.
